Transaction 3250600944540f99fb9f0740e974dad97c6bafcc64bf89fc194691cb915b29cd
1 Input
1 Output
-
3250600944540f99fb9f0740e974dad97c6bafcc64bf89fc194691cb915b29cd:0
- value
- 17733300
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 49b88465cf7161acf0df048e99fbf0adb92d7c7e OP_EQUAL
- address
- 38QpJ2Sh2uC5uEQMdUQ3GTEm1sf48Wb4CM